When is the best time to stay at a B&B in Xylofagou?
When you’re planning your escape to Xylofagou, year-round temperatures and rainfall may be important factors to consider. The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 82°F, while the coldest months are February and January with an average of 59°F. Average annual precipitation for Xylofagou is 11 inches.

How can I get to and around Xylofagou?
You can map out your trip in and around Xylofagou ahead of time with these transportation options. Fly into Larnaca Intl. Airport (LCA), which is located 14.5 mi (23.4 km) away from the city center. If you’d like to venture out around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
